Zimbabwe: women arrested at Catholic church
Police on Tuesday arrested ten women, one of whom was carrying a one -year old child, as they gathered at St Patrick's Church in Bulawayo for the start of an International Women's Day march. The women were members of the Women of Zimbabwe Arise (WOZA) activist group. They were kept in custody overnight and expected to appear in court yesterday. WOZA official Magodonga Mahlangu told ZimOnline: "The police have absolutely no respect for women and we are saying we will never relent in our fight for the emancipation of women by Mugabe and his regime.
